Combining apical and parasternal views to improve motion estimation in real-time 3D echocardiographic sequences
- Abstract:
-
Real-time 3D echocardiography (RT3DE), while offering obvious advantages over traditional two-dimensional echocardiography, is hampered by its limited image quality. This makes it difficult to apply accurate quantitative analysis tools that fully exploit this modality. We propose to overcome this limitation by combining views from different echocardiographic windows.
